This first book of the Here I Am! series tells the real-life story of Dietrich Bonhoeffer who loved God and his neighbor, even when it cost him his life. This series highlights fascinating and faithful Christians in history for kids ages 4-8.

Written by Molly Frye Wilmington, Illustrated by Marcin Piwowarski

“A compelling story about a noble person and a skillful storyteller make for a great children’s book, and that is what we find in Molly Wilmington’s Dietrich Bonhoeffer: The Teacher Who Became a Spy. Bonhoeffer’s winsome life and courageous witness have inspired and guided millions since his death in 1945, and with this volume girls and boys will be introduced to his exemplary life of faith, insight and hope. Families and churches will definitely want to have this book in their libraries.”

-Dr. Barry Harvey, published Dietrich Bonhoeffer scholar, Professor of Theology in Great Texts and Religion at Baylor University. Dr. Harvey has served on the Board of the International Bonhoeffer Society, English Language Section, and on the Editorial Board of the Dietrich Bonhoeffer Works (DBWE)

The English Language Section is dedicated to advancing the theology and legacy of German pastor-theologian and Nazi resister, Dietrich Bonhoeffer, in the academy, church, and world, and has been on the forefront of this work for the last fifty years.
